Exploring Roanoke's Neighborhoods

Roanoke's diverse neighborhoods offer something for everyone, from the historic charm of Gainsboro to the modern amenities of Downtown. The city's most desirable areas include:

  • Downtown Roanoke: A vibrant mix of historic homes, modern condos, and entertainment venues.
  • Gainsboro: A historic neighborhood known for its charming architecture and cultural significance.
  • Northwest Roanoke: Suburban areas with a more laid-back atmosphere and easy access to outdoor recreation.

When searching for a home in Roanoke, consider factors like commute time, local amenities, and school districts to find the best fit for your needs.

Down Payment Assistance Programs in Virginia

The Virginia Housing Development Authority (VHDA) offers several down payment assistance programs to help homebuyers overcome the upfront costs of purchasing a home. These programs include:

  • VHDA Down Payment Assistance Grant: Provides up to $5,000 in grant funding for down payment and closing costs.
  • VHDA First-Time Homebuyer Program: Offers favorable loan terms and down payment assistance for eligible borrowers.

Understanding Property Taxes in Roanoke

As a homeowner in Roanoke, you'll need to factor property taxes into your overall housing expenses. The city's average effective property tax rate is approximately 0.82%, which is slightly higher than the statewide average. To give you a better understanding of the costs involved, here's a breakdown of the average annual property taxes in Roanoke:

  • Median home value: $220,000
  • Average annual property taxes: $1,804

Roanoke City Public Schools serve the area, with several highly-rated schools in the district. Homebuyers often prioritize neighborhoods served by top-performing schools, which can drive up property values. In Roanoke, homes located in the attendance zones of schools like Roanoke High School and Virginia Heights Elementary tend to command a premium. When searching for a home, it's worth researching the local school district and its impact on property values.
